TNT’s Crime Family Drama Animal Kingdom Renewed for Fifth Season

The gritty crime drama Animal Kingdom will be back for more after being renewed for a fifth season on TNT.

Following the crime-riddled Cody family, Animal Kingdom has been packed with action and outrageous crime escapades since 2016. In the show’s current season, family matriarch Smurf is back on top of the totem pole and isn’t going to let herself be knocked back down. While Smurf is supposedly running the family, her sons are scheming and planning their own reckless heists to make a name for themselves in the family business, all while outside forces are trying to mess with the state of the Cody family.

The series stars Ellen Barkin, Shawn Hatosy, Ben Robson, Jake Weary, Finn Cole and Sovhi Rodriguez. The fourth season also brought in Emily Deschanel in a recurring role, as well as Leila George as a young Smurf.

The series is inspired by the 2010 Australian film from David Michôd (War Machine) and Liz Watts (The Rover). Both Michôd and Watts serve as executive producers on the series, which was developed for television by Jonathan Lisco (Halt and Catch Fire). John Wells (American Woman) and Eliza Clark (The Killing) serve as executive producers, as well.

The show has steadily grown since its beginning, and the latest season has brought in around 18 million viewers across all platforms. The show is also part of TNT’s thriving group of drama series, including Claws, The Alienist, I Am The Night and the forthcoming The Alienist: Angel of Darkness.
